UFC Fighter Sedriques Dumas was arrested in Florida on Monday, just a few weeks after his last fight in the octagon, and remains in police custody with a long list of accusations, including flights and battery charges.
The 29 -year -old fighter was sentenced to the County of Escambia in Pensacola, Florida, Monday and held on a deposit of $ 558,500, according to online files.

The Details of Dumas’ Arrest Were NOT IMMEDIATELY KNOWN, But Records indicate he is facing a multitude of charges included Home-Invasion Robbery, felony possession of a weapon by a convicted felon, felony possession of a controlled substance, misdemeanor battery and misdemeanor Drug Equipment possession and or use New York Post reported.
Monday’s arrest occurred for more than two weeks after his fight to UFC 314 in Miami, Where he lost through Michal Oleksiejczuk in the preliminaries of the average weight. Dumas, who goes through the nickname “The Reaper”, has a 10-3-0 file with four victories browse.

The recent arrest of Dumas marks its 14th in more than a decade, MMA Junkie reported.
He was already arrested in February 2024 following an alleged incident of domestic violence with his child’s mother when he was accused of slapping her. These accusations were then rejected.

According to prison files, Dumas must have brought to justice on May 6.
